EVAS 20 lb. Propane Exchange Tanks Recalled for Fire Hazard

Agency Publication Date: February 22, 2024

Summary

Worthington Enterprises is recalling about 146,160 EVAS 20-lb. propane exchange cylinders (model EVAS - M0859) because they can leak gas. These tanks were initially sold with an AmeriGas label, but they may have been rebranded by other distributors during the exchange process. While no injuries have been reported, consumers should immediately stop using these cylinders and return them to an AmeriGas location for a free replacement.

Risk

The recalled cylinders can leak gas, creating a significant fire hazard if the leaking gas is ignited. No incidents or injuries have been reported to date.

What You Should Do

  1. This recall affects EVAS 20-lb. propane exchange cylinders with model number EVAS - M0859, a serial number beginning with 'W', and a date code of either '06-23' or '07-23'.
  2. Check the metal collar of the cylinder for the model number, serial number, and date code stamped into the metal; the tank may feature an AmeriGas label or a branded sleeve from another propane distributor.
  3. Stop using the recalled propane cylinder immediately and ensure the top valve is closed completely.
  4. Return the cylinder to any AmeriGas Propane Exchange retail location to receive a free replacement; you can find a participating location at https://www.amerigas.com/locations/find-propane.
  5. Contact Worthington Enterprises toll-free at 888-520-1304 from 8 a.m. to 7 p.m. ET Monday through Friday, via email at propanecylinders@realtimeresults.net, or online at https://www.recallrtr.com/PropaneCylinders for more information.
  6. Call the CPSC Hotline at 800-638-2772 if you have additional questions.

Affected Products

Product: EVAS 20-lb. propane exchange cylinders
Model:
EVAS - M0859
Serial Numbers:
Serial numbers beginning with W
Lot Numbers:
06-23
07-23
Date Ranges: Sold July 2023 through August 2023

Model number, serial number, and date code are stamped on the collar of the cylinder. Tanks may be branded with AmeriGas or other distributor labels.

Additional Information

Agency: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C)
Recall ID: 24124
Status: Active
Sold By: AmeriGas; Propane cylinder exchange suppliers
Distributor: AmeriGas, of King of Prussia, Pennsylvania
Manufactured In: Turkey
Units Affected: About 146,160
Distributed To: New Hampshire, Massachusetts
Importer: Worthington Enterprises, of Columbus, Ohio
